Abstract
The high temperature superconducting (HTS) tape has low index value compared with the 1st generation superconductor based on the power-law model of V-I characteristics because of its intrinsic characteristics of weak-link and low pinning potential. So, there is potential drop resulting in joule heat called index loss when it operates below quench. To search a way for researching, the Weibull distributions of critical current and n-value in turns of a model double-pancake (DP), made of coated conductor, are numerically calculated based on anisotropic empirical models obtained by fitting the experimental data in the temperature of 77 K. And also the index loss of double-pancake (DP) is also calculated. Then, the double-pancake is tested at 77 K, furthermore the simulative results are quietly approaching the experimental results. Finally the optimal operation current for this DP is discovered.
